The Descent into Gloom: Tiefling Holy Warrior Builds

Few unions seem more paradoxical than a Tiefling channeling the powers of a Paladin. Despite the inherent association with demonic origins, these builds offer a compelling, and often surprisingly effective, mix of righteous fury and infernal resilience. This isn't your typical shining example of goodness; these are warriors who fight against the shadows, often *because* they understand them. Consider the Oath of Vengeance Tiefling, a tormented soul committed to eradicating evil, fueled by the pain of their own heritage. Or perhaps a Conquest Paladin, dominating the battlefield with the strength granted by their ancestry .

  • Consider the Oath of Redemption for a path of atonement .
  • The Oath of Devotion provides a unique challenge, proving that even a Tiefling can maintain ideals.
  • A Twilight Paladin can uniquely leverage their heritage for powerful abilities.
Ultimately, a Tiefling Paladin build presents a rich opportunity to craft a truly distinct character tale.
